Student opportunities and activities
At Fernhill School, we offer a variety of programs in the classroom and across the school to help students build new skills, make friends and explore new interests.
Our programs may include:
- school sport
- inter-school competitions including athletics, boccia and bowling
- creative and performing arts groups including choir and dance group
- cultural and language activities
- excursions and incursions
- student leadership opportunities.

Our extra-curricular highlights

Sporting opportunities
Students have the opportunity to participate in different sports as part of the PDHPE curriculum. Students may also be selected to participate in sporting activities offered by The School Sport Unit, including Boccia, Come-and-Try Athletics, Multi-Sport days, swimming carnivals and Tenpin Bowling.

Creative and performing arts
Our school choir and dance group allow students to express themselves through music. They are able to experience the thrill of performing before an audience in shows and concerts such as the Synergy Dance Festival and the Penrith Eisteddfod.
